What are the responsibilities and job description for the Special Inspector position at Soils & Structures?
This individual with specialized skills observes critical building or structural elements identified in the statement of special inspections for compliance with plans and specifications approved by the building official.
Job Responsibilities:
- Check the details of construction against submitted plans, codes, and standards.
- Special inspections apply principally to the structural framing system of the building. The structural framing system includes the foundation, walls, columns, floors, beams, trusses, and roof.
- Nonstructural components include fireproofing and EIFS
- Pre-installation verification testing of bolts
- Conduct structural testing for building foundations, walls, columns, floors, beams, trusses, and roof.
- Continuous education: CEU’s to renew certification, NDT certification, knowledge in the IBC, MBC, AISC Steel Construction Manual and AWS Welding Codes.
